Oracle数据库课件教学课件_第1页
Oracle数据库课件教学课件_第2页
Oracle数据库课件教学课件_第3页
Oracle数据库课件教学课件_第4页
Oracle数据库课件教学课件_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

Oracle数据库课件XX有限公司汇报人:XX目录第一章Oracle数据库概述第二章Oracle数据库安装第四章Oracle数据库操作第三章Oracle数据库结构第六章Oracle数据库高级特性第五章Oracle数据库安全Oracle数据库概述第一章数据库基本概念数据模型是数据库结构的抽象表示,包括概念模型、逻辑模型和物理模型。数据模型事务管理确保数据库操作的原子性、一致性、隔离性和持久性,是数据库系统的核心功能。事务管理数据独立性指的是数据结构的变化不影响应用程序,分为逻辑独立性和物理独立性。数据独立性数据冗余指的是存储在数据库中的重复数据,而一致性是指数据状态的正确性和完整性。数据冗余与一致性01020304Oracle数据库特点Oracle数据库支持大量并发用户和事务处理,适用于大型企业级应用。强大的数据处理能力提供RAC和DataGuard等技术,确保数据库的高可用性和快速故障恢复。高可用性和故障恢复Oracle数据库内置复杂的安全机制,如细粒度访问控制和透明数据加密,保障数据安全。先进的安全性特性Oracle提供丰富的开发工具,如SQLDeveloper和APEX,简化应用开发和部署过程。全面的开发工具支持Oracle版本历史Oracle7在1992年发布,引入了多线程服务器架构,显著提升了数据库性能。Oracle7的推出1997年推出的Oracle8引入了对象关系特性,支持面向对象编程,扩展了数据库功能。Oracle8的革新Oracle版本历史2013年推出的Oracle12c引入了多租户架构,优化了云环境下的数据库管理和服务交付。Oracle12c的多租户架构2003年发布的Oracle10g是首个带有网格计算功能的版本,为云计算服务奠定了基础。Oracle10g的云服务Oracle数据库安装第二章系统要求分析Oracle数据库对服务器的CPU、内存和存储空间有较高要求,确保系统稳定高效运行。硬件配置需求Oracle数据库支持多种操作系统,如Linux、Windows等,需根据实际环境选择合适版本。操作系统兼容性良好的网络环境是Oracle数据库正常运行的基础,包括稳定的IP地址和足够的带宽。网络环境要求安装步骤详解确保操作系统满足Oracle数据库安装的最低硬件和软件要求,如内存、磁盘空间和操作系统版本。01系统要求检查备份重要数据,检查系统兼容性,下载并安装必要的依赖软件包,如Java和gcc。02安装前的准备工作运行Oracle安装程序,遵循安装向导的指示,选择安装类型,配置数据库选项和网络设置。03安装过程安装步骤详解01设置ORACLE_HOME、ORACLE_SID等环境变量,确保数据库实例能够正确启动和运行。02通过运行测试脚本和连接测试来验证安装是否成功,确保数据库服务正常运行。配置环境变量安装后的验证安装后的配置配置监听器安装Oracle后,需要配置监听器以便数据库能够接受来自客户端的连接请求。配置网络服务名设置网络服务名(TNSNames.ora)或使用OracleNetConfigurationAssistant配置客户端连接信息。设置环境变量创建数据库实例配置环境变量如ORACLE_HOME和PATH,确保系统能够找到Oracle的可执行文件和库文件。通过运行dbca命令或使用图形界面创建新的数据库实例,为数据库操作提供基础环境。Oracle数据库结构第三章数据库体系架构Oracle数据库的逻辑存储结构包括表空间、段、区和数据块,它们共同管理数据的存储。逻辑存储结构01Oracle数据库的内存结构由系统全局区(SGA)和程序全局区(PGA)组成,负责数据的快速访问和处理。内存结构02Oracle数据库通过服务器进程和后台进程来处理用户请求和维护数据库的运行,如DBWn和LGWR进程。进程结构03数据库对象类型在Oracle数据库中,表是存储数据的基本单位,用于组织和存储用户信息。表(Tables)0102视图是基于SQL语句的结果集的虚拟表,提供了一种限制用户访问特定数据的方式。视图(Views)03索引用于加快数据检索速度,通过创建索引,可以优化数据库查询性能。索引(Indexes)数据库对象类型存储过程(StoredProcedures)存储过程是一组为了完成特定功能的SQL语句集,可以被存储在数据库中并多次调用。0102触发器(Triggers)触发器是数据库中自动执行的程序,响应特定的数据库事件,如INSERT、UPDATE或DELETE操作。存储结构介绍重做日志文件数据文件0103重做日志文件记录了数据库的所有修改操作,用于数据恢复和保证事务的完整性。Oracle数据库的数据文件存储实际的数据,如表、索引等,是数据库的物理组成部分。02控制文件记录了数据库的结构信息,包括数据文件和日志文件的位置,是数据库恢复的关键。控制文件Oracle数据库操作第四章SQL语言基础数据查询语言DQL使用SELECT语句进行数据检索,如SELECT*FROMemployees查询员工表所有数据。数据操纵语言DML数据控制语言DCL利用GRANT和REVOKE语句进行权限的授予和回收,控制用户对数据的操作权限。通过INSERT、UPDATE、DELETE语句对数据库进行数据的增加、修改和删除操作。数据定义语言DDL使用CREATE、ALTER、DROP等语句创建、修改或删除数据库中的表结构。数据库管理命令使用`startup`和`shutdown`命令来启动和关闭Oracle数据库,确保数据的正常访问和维护。启动和关闭数据库利用`backup`和`restore`命令进行数据备份,使用`recover`命令来恢复数据库到特定状态。数据备份与恢复通过`createuser`和`grant`命令创建新用户并分配权限,管理数据库的安全访问。用户和权限管理数据库维护任务定期备份Oracle数据库是关键维护任务,确保数据安全,如使用RMAN工具进行备份和恢复。备份与恢复策略定期清理无用数据,归档旧数据,释放存储空间,保持数据库的整洁和高效运行。数据清理与归档监控数据库性能,定期执行优化任务,如分析SQL语句,调整内存分配,以提高系统效率。性能监控与优化执行安全审计,更新数据库安全设置,防止未授权访问,确保数据安全和合规性。安全审计与更新01020304Oracle数据库安全第五章用户与权限管理在Oracle数据库中,通过创建用户账户并分配角色和权限来控制访问,确保数据安全。创建和管理用户账户角色是权限的集合,通过创建特定角色并将其分配给用户,可以简化权限管理过程。角色的创建与分配Oracle允许数据库管理员授予或回收用户对数据库对象的访问权限,以保护数据不被未授权访问。权限的授予与回收通过审计功能,数据库管理员可以追踪用户对数据库的操作,确保数据操作的透明性和合规性。审计用户活动数据加密技术Oracle数据库使用AES和DES算法进行数据加密,保证数据在存储和传输过程中的安全。对称加密技术利用RSA算法,Oracle数据库可以实现密钥的分发和管理,确保数据传输的安全性。非对称加密技术数据加密技术Oracle的透明数据加密功能可以自动加密数据文件,无需修改应用程序,增强数据安全性。01透明数据加密通过SSL/TLS协议,Oracle数据库加密客户端和服务器之间的通信,防止数据在传输过程中被截获。02网络加密审计与监控在Oracle数据库中,制定审计策略是监控数据库活动的关键步骤,确保记录所有重要操作。审计策略的制定使用Oracle提供的实时监控工具,如OracleEnterpriseManager,可以即时跟踪数据库性能和安全事件。实时监控工具分析审计日志可以帮助数据库管理员发现异常行为,及时采取措施防止数据泄露或滥用。审计日志的分析Oracle数据库高级特性第六章高可用性解决方案OracleDataGuard提供数据保护,通过创建和维护一个或多个备用数据库来实现故障转移和灾难恢复。OracleDataGuard01RAC允许多个服务器实例同时访问同一个数据库,提供高可用性和可扩展性,确保关键业务连续性。RealApplicationClusters(RAC)02ASM简化了存储管理,自动分配和管理数据库文件,提高了存储的可用性和性能。AutomaticStorageManagement(ASM)03数据库性能优化合理创建和管理索引可以显著提高查询效率,减少数据检索时间。索引优化优化SQL语句,避免全表扫描,使用绑定变量减少硬解析,提升执行效率。SQL语句调优调整SGA和PGA的大小,确保数据库有足够的内存处理数据,减少磁盘I/O操作。内存管理通过数据分区技术,将大表分割成小块,提高数据访问速度和维护效率。数据分区定期更新数据库统计信息,帮助优化器选择更有效的执行计划,优化查询性能。统计信息更新大数据与云计算Oracle提供云数据库服务,支持企业将数据库部署在云端,实现

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论